Dependency graph: tokens.js <- decorations <- atoms <- pages <- Tome.svelte
No overflow:hidden on page roots. That CSS property inside a preserve-3d context forces the browser to flatten 3D rendering. Clipping is handled by the leaf face wrappers in Tome.svelte.
Transitions gated per-leaf. CSS transitions are "none" unless a specific leaf is mid-flip. This eliminates the orientation-switch animation race condition and avoids applying transitions to non-animating leaves.
Deterministic orientation mapping. Lookup tables (not proportional math) map between portrait and landscape positions. Each entry is hand-verified against the content layout.
willChange only on animating leaf. Permanent will-change: transform wastes GPU memory. Only the leaf currently mid-flip gets GPU compositing.
Font loading in Astro. Fonts are loaded via <link> in index.astro with preconnect, not injected via {@html} at runtime. This avoids duplicate <style> elements and enables browser-level preloading.
Svelte 5 idioms. Direct component rendering (<Page />), $derived.by() for complex derivations, $props() throughout. No svelte:component.
Run the accessibility suite on its own:
pnpm test:a11y
Two checks fire:
tests/accessibility.spec.ts — runs @axe-core/playwright against every published route. Covers ARIA, landmarks, alt text, heading order, focus management, and color contrast on real rendered DOM. Two rules are explicitly disabled and the reasoning is in-file: aria-hidden-focus (the tome's offscreen leaves are intentionally hidden) and page-has-heading-one (the book's canonical h1 lives on the cover leaf, which is inert on non-cover routes; the book metaphor defeats this best-practice heuristic).tests/contrast.spec.ts — pure-data check that every --tome-* foreground/background pair we actually render meets its declared WCAG ratio (4.5:1 body, 3:1 large). Runs offline; sub-second.Architectural notes:
